The Air Quality Index (AQI) is a tool used to gauge air pollution levels, categorizing them into color-coded alerts that indicate health implications. The Code Red designation correlates to an AQI value ranging from 151 to 200. At this level, health warnings are issued, particularly for sensitive demographics:
Exposure to Code Red air can provoke respiratory issues, exacerbate asthma, and increase the risk of cardiovascular problems. As the frequency of such alerts rises, understanding how to mitigate risks becomes increasingly important.
